Quality Engineer

3 months ago


Delphos, Ohio, United States Danfoss Full time
Job Description

This position will lead quality projects engaging customers, manufacturing operations, and suppliers leveraging problem solving techniques to improve and sustain plant quality performance metrics. Key driver of quality improvements within our site which will have a direct impact with customers and supply base as an integral part of our business in the drive for zero defects quality performance.

Job Responsibilities
  • Lead/support process assessments and other performance improvement activities within our site
  • Lead weekly reviews on quality performance metrics identifying and driving improvements with the use of data analytics and problem-solving tools.
  • Lead monthly quality performance and project status review of quality projects.
  • Support/lead deployment of IATF QMS requirements within our site participating in our Internal Audit process.
  • Lead/support validation of the implementation of corrective / improvement actions across our value stream (supplier, plant, customer) when needed, to assess effectiveness of improvements.
  • Support deployment of risk mitigation activities across our value stream, to proactively identify and address potential quality risks.
  • Monitor customer / supplier performance on a timely manner to proactively address potential issues.
Background & Skills

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ree at an accredited institution
  • Minimum three (3) years of combined experience in a Quality role in operations

Preferred Qualifications

  • Certified lead internal auditor (ISO9001 / IATF16949)
  • 8D structured team problem solving methods.
  • Green belt/black belt certification
  • Expert in AIAG PPAP Production Part Approval Process
  • Experience with AIAG Design and Process FMEA
  • Experience in the use of SAP (ERP system)
  • Knowledge on engineering drawings & tolerancing, standards & specifications

Fabrication, machining, and assembly knowledge and experience is preferred
